MySQL数据库无法正常使用可能有多种原因。以下是一些常见的问题和解决方法:
- 连接问题:检查是否能够成功连接到数据库。可以使用MySQL命令行工具或者其他客户端工具尝试连接。如果无法连接,可能是用户名、密码或者主机地址配置不正确。确保这些信息正确无误。
- 端口问题:MySQL默认使用3306端口进行通信,确保该端口没有被防火墙或其他网络安全设置阻止。也可以尝试使用telnet命令检查该端口是否能够正常通信。
- 权限问题:确保MySQL用户拥有足够的权限来执行所需的操作。可以使用GRANT语句为用户授予相应的权限。
- 存储空间问题:检查数据库所在的磁盘分区或者存储空间是否已满。如果是,需要释放一些空间来确保数据库正常工作。
- 错误日志:查看MySQL的错误日志文件,通常位于MySQL安装目录的"logs"文件夹下。日志文件中会记录一些错误信息,可以帮助定位问题。
- 服务是否启动:确保MySQL服务已经启动。可以在操作系统中查看服务列表,或者使用命令行工具来检查服务状态。
如果以上解决方法都无效,可以考虑重启MySQL服务或者重新安装MySQL。如果问题仍然存在,可能需要进一步分析或者联系技术支持人员。
对于MySQL数据库,它是一个开源的关系型数据库管理系统,被广泛应用于Web应用和其他数据驱动的应用程序中。它具有以下特点和优势:
- 可靠性:MySQL提供了数据备份和故障恢复机制,可以保护数据的安全性和完整性。
- 可扩展性:MySQL可以通过添加更多的服务器节点来实现水平扩展,从而提高系统的处理能力。
- 性能:MySQL在处理大量数据时表现出色,并且支持索引、缓存和查询优化等机制来提升查询性能。
- 灵活性:MySQL支持多种存储引擎,可以根据应用程序的需求选择不同的存储引擎,例如InnoDB、MyISAM等。
MySQL适用于各种应用场景,包括但不限于:
- Web应用程序:MySQL被广泛应用于各种Web应用程序中,包括电子商务网站、论坛、博客等。
- 数据分析:MySQL可以存储和管理大量数据,并且支持复杂的查询操作,因此适用于数据分析和报表生成等任务。
- 日志记录:MySQL可以用于记录应用程序的日志信息,包括用户活动、错误日志等。
- 嵌入式系统:MySQL提供了嵌入式库,可以将数据库集成到嵌入式系统中,例如移动设备、路由器等。
在腾讯云的产品中,推荐使用的与MySQL相关的产品包括:
- 云数据库MySQL:腾讯云提供的一种高性能、高可用性的托管式MySQL数据库服务。它提供了弹性扩容、自动备份、故障恢复等功能,可根据需求选择不同的规格和配置。
- 数据库审计:腾讯云提供的数据库审计服务,可以记录和审计MySQL数据库的操作,帮助用户满足合规性和安全性的要求。
更多关于腾讯云MySQL相关产品和产品介绍,请参考腾讯云官方网站: